SSIZE_T WinSequentialFile::PositionedReadInternal(char* src, size_t numBytes,
uint64_t offset) const {
return pread(GetFileHandle(), src, numBytes, offset);
}

Status WinSequentialFile::PositionedRead(uint64_t offset, size_t n, Slice* result,
char* scratch) {

Status s;

assert(WinFileData::use_direct_io());

// Windows ReadFile API accepts a DWORD.
// While it is possible to read in a loop if n is > UINT_MAX
// it is a highly unlikely case.
if (n > UINT_MAX) {
return IOErrorFromWindowsError(GetName(), ERROR_INVALID_PARAMETER);
}

auto r = PositionedReadInternal(scratch, n, offset);

if (r < 0) {
auto lastError = GetLastError();
// Posix impl wants to treat reads from beyond
// of the file as OK.
if (lastError != ERROR_HANDLE_EOF) {
s = IOErrorFromWindowsError(GetName(), lastError);
}
}

*result = Slice(scratch, (r < 0) ? 0 : size_t(r));
return s;
}
